PGLDN distributes customized wheelchairs, prosthetic legs to 42 PWDs

TUBOD, Lanao del Norte (PIA)-- Some 42 persons with disabilities (PWDs) in this province received customized wheelchairs and artificial legs or prosthetics from the provincial government at the Provincial Capitol Lobby on January 9.

Governor Imelda 'Angging' Quibranza-Dimaporo led the distribution of said restorative devices, 32 customized wheelchairs, and 10 artificial legs, to recipients coming from 10 municipalities.

This yearly initiative of the provincial government and implementation by the Provincial Social Welfare and Development Office (PSWDO) aims to give the PWD sector the help they require and to make them feel supported and loved by assisting them in achieving the greatest improvements in their physical residual capacities.

In her message, Dimpaoro lauded the efforts of the PSWDO and underscored the importance of peace and unity for better service delivery to the people. She also stated that the doors of the provincial capitol are always open for all, for it exists for the people.
"Kami dinhi sa probinsya, kung unsa among makaya na ihatag sa atong mga kaigsuonan, paningkamutan namo mahatag, muduol lang kamo sa atong mga departamento [We, here in the province, will strive to give what we can to our fellow residents. Feel free to approach our departments]," she said.

Meanwhile, Rogelio Villaruz, a resident of Lapinig, Kapatagan, was very happy to receive his new artificial legs because he can now easily carry out his daily activities.

"Sa ngalan sa mga parehas namo nga mga disabled, naay kapansanan, dako kaayo among pasalamat sa imoha Gov ug sa kini na programa sa PSWDO [On behalf of fellow individuals with disabilities who have impairments, we are very grateful to you, Governor, and to this program of the PSWDO]," he said.

The provincial government annually allocates the budget for PWDs in the province through the proposals submitted by PSWDO in coordination with the respective Municipal Social Welfare and Development Offices of the different towns.

Aside from the assistive devices, the beneficiaries also received 10 kilos of rice and Christmas food packs each. Prior to the distribution, the recipients also sang a birthday song to the governor, who will be celebrating her birthday next week.

"Hinaot hatagan pa ka og kahimsog sa panlawas ug kusog alang sa pagserbisyo sa atong probinsya, ilabina sa among sektor sa PWD [We hope you are granted good health and strength to serve our province, especially the PWD sector]," Allan Rosario, one of the recipients of customized wheelchairs, said.
